Install

pip install kaida-shield

Quick Start

# See Kaida in action — live threat detection demo
kaida demo

# Open the visual dashboard
kaida ui

# Scan a suspicious URL
kaida scan url https://suspicious-site.com

# Scan a command before running it
kaida scan cmd "curl http://example.com | bash"

# Run your bot with protection
kaida shield run --policy web_scrape python my_bot.py

# See all options
kaida --help

What Kaida Protects Against

  • Phishing — fake login pages, credential harvesting, impersonation sites
  • Malicious commands — reverse shells, crypto miners, unauthorized scripts
  • Data theft — unauthorized file access, data exfiltration attempts
  • Prompt injection — attackers hijacking your bot's instructions
  • Unauthorized access — bots reaching websites or folders you didn't approve

Quick Start Templates

Get running in seconds with built-in policy templates:

kaida shield run --policy email_assistant python my_email_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y web_researcher python my_research_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y file_organizer python my_file_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y social_media python my_social_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y code_assistant python my_code_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y customer_support python my_support_bot.py
kaida shield run --policy data_analyst python my_data_bot.py

Each template comes with sensible defaults — allow what the bot needs, block everything else.

Multi-Agent Protection

Running multiple bots? Create a separate policy for each one. Your email bot, research bot, and social media bot each get their own rules. Kaida monitors them independently — one bot misbehaving doesn't affect the others.
